What Is a Bail Bond?

A bail bond is a monetary agreement that allows an arrested individual to be released from safekeeping while waiting for trial. This arrangement involves a 3rd party, commonly a Bail bondsman, who assures the court that the individual will certainly return for their scheduled court looks. In exchange for this solution, the Bail bondsman normally bills a non-refundable fee, usually a portion of the overall Bail quantity.

Bail bonds serve a crucial function in the lawful system, providing a device for defendants to maintain their freedom during the pre-trial phase. This can assist them plan for their protection a lot more successfully. The Bail amount is determined by the court based upon various aspects, including the intensity of the violation, the offender's criminal history, and the danger of trip. Inevitably, a bail bond represents a commitment to maintain legal duties while enabling people the opportunity to continue their day-to-days live up until their court date.

Just How Bail Bonds Job

Bail bonds run with a simple process that includes a number of crucial actions. A defendant or their depictive get in touches with a bail bond representative after an arrest. The agent examines the circumstance, consisting of the Bail amount established by the court and the accused's background. Once a decision is made, the agent usually needs a non-refundable cost, typically a percent of the overall Bail quantity, typically varying from 10% to 15%.

After the charge is paid, the representative secures the Bail by signing a contract with the court, ensuring that the accused stands for all set up court dates. If the offender fails to appear, the bail bond agent is accountable for the full Bail quantity, leading the agent to seek the offender. Throughout this process, the bail bond representative plays an essential function in facilitating the release of the defendant while handling the linked economic dangers.

Types of Bail Bonds

Comprehending the different sorts of Bail bonds is important for defendants and their households as they browse the lawful system. There are numerous common sorts of Bail bonds offered, each offering a details objective.

One of the most widespread is the guaranty bond, which entails a bondsman assuring the full Bail quantity for a cost. An additional kind is the money bond, where the offender or their family pays the full Bail amount in money directly to the court.

Residential or commercial property bonds allow people to make use of realty as security for the Bail quantity. Additionally, federal bonds specify to federal cases, frequently requiring a higher premium and more strict conditions.

Finally, migration bonds are made use of in instances worrying immigration offenses. Each sort of bond has distinctive treatments and effects, making it crucial for those included to understand their alternatives thoroughly.


The Costs Involved in Protecting a Bail Bond



Protecting a bail bond entails various costs that can substantially affect an accused's finances. The major expense is the costs, commonly ranging from 10% to 15% of the total Bail quantity set by the court. This costs is non-refundable, despite the situation outcome, standing for the bail bond agent's cost for their services. Added costs might consist of administrative fees, which some representatives enforce for processing documentation, and collateral demands, where the accused might need to supply properties to protect the bond. Obligations of the Indemnitor

Guiding via the intricacies of Bail bonds needs a clear understanding of the responsibilities of the indemnitor. The indemnitor, typically a family member or close friend of the offender, plays a substantial duty in the Bail procedure. This specific accepts think economic responsibility, ensuring that the Bail amount is paid if the defendant stops working to appear in court. It is essential for the indemnitor to preserve communication with the bail bond representative throughout the procedure, providing any kind of essential details and updates concerning the defendant's situation.

Additionally, the indemnitor must secure security, which might include residential property or prized possessions, to back the bail bond. Typical Misconceptions Concerning Bail Bonds

Several individuals nurture false impressions concerning Bail bonds, which can complicate their understanding of the Bail process. One common myth is that Bail bonds are a kind of repayment that assures an accused's launch. In truth, they are an assurance to the court that the defendant will certainly stand for their set up hearings. One more usual idea is that just affluent people can pay for Bail. However, Bail bondsmen commonly bill a percentage of the total Bail quantity, making it available to a more comprehensive array of individuals. Additionally, some individuals believe that Bail is refundable. While the premium paid to the bondsman is not refundable, the Bail quantity itself may be returned upon the conclusion of the situation, provided the defendant satisfies all court needs.
